阐述什么是编程的核心要素
-
编程的核心要素是指在进行编程过程中,必不可少的关键要素。这些要素包括算法、数据结构、编程语言和软件工程。
首先,算法是编程的核心要素之一。算法是解决问题的步骤和方法的描述,它决定了程序的执行过程和结果。一个好的算法能够高效地解决问题,提高程序的执行速度和效率。
其次,数据结构也是编程的核心要素之一。数据结构是组织和存储数据的方式,它决定了程序对数据的操作和处理方式。选择合适的数据结构能够提高程序的性能和可维护性。
编程语言是编程的核心要素之一。编程语言是用来编写程序的工具,它定义了程序的语法和语义。选择合适的编程语言能够提高开发效率和程序的可读性。
最后,软件工程也是编程的核心要素之一。软件工程是对软件开发过程的管理和组织,它包括需求分析、设计、编码、测试和维护等环节。良好的软件工程实践能够提高软件开发的效率和质量。
综上所述,算法、数据结构、编程语言和软件工程是编程的核心要素。它们相互依赖、相互影响,共同构成了编程的基础。掌握这些核心要素,能够帮助程序员更好地理解和解决问题,提高编程能力和开发效率。
1年前 -
编程的核心要素是指构成编程活动的基本组成部分和关键要点。以下是编程的五个核心要素:
-
逻辑思维:编程是一种逻辑思维的活动。它要求程序员能够清晰地分析问题,理解问题的本质和需求,并能够将问题分解为一系列的逻辑步骤。逻辑思维能力是编程的基础,它决定了程序员能否正确地理解和解决问题。
-
编程语言:编程语言是程序员用来编写代码的工具。不同的编程语言有不同的语法和特性,但它们都提供了一系列的命令和结构,用于描述程序的逻辑和行为。熟练掌握一种或多种编程语言是成为优秀程序员的基本要求。
-
数据结构和算法:数据结构和算法是编程的核心。数据结构是指程序中用于存储和组织数据的方式,而算法是指解决问题的具体步骤和方法。程序员需要了解不同的数据结构和算法,并能够选择合适的数据结构和算法来解决问题,以提高程序的效率和性能。
-
软件工程:软件工程是一种系统化的方法和技术,用于开发和维护高质量的软件。它包括需求分析、设计、编码、测试和维护等过程。程序员需要了解软件工程的原则和方法,以确保程序的可靠性、可维护性和可扩展性。
-
调试和排错:调试和排错是编程过程中不可避免的一部分。当程序出现错误或不符合预期时,程序员需要能够追踪和定位问题,并采取适当的措施来修复错误。调试和排错能力是程序员的重要技能之一,它能够帮助程序员提高程序的质量和稳定性。
综上所述,逻辑思维、编程语言、数据结构和算法、软件工程以及调试和排错是编程的核心要素。掌握这些要素可以帮助程序员更好地理解和解决问题,开发出高质量的软件。
1年前 -
-
编程的核心要素是指构成程序的基本组成部分。它们包括数据、算法、语法和逻辑。
一、数据
数据是程序中最基本的要素,它是程序的输入、输出和运算的基础。数据可以是各种各样的形式,包括数字、文字、图像、音频等。在编程中,我们需要定义和处理数据,包括数据的类型、变量的声明和赋值等操作。二、算法
算法是解决问题的步骤和方法的描述。它是程序的核心,决定了程序的执行流程和结果。算法需要清晰、准确地描述问题的解决过程,包括输入、处理和输出的步骤。编程中,我们需要选择和设计合适的算法来解决问题。三、语法
语法是编程语言的规则和约定,用于定义程序的结构和语法。不同的编程语言有不同的语法规则,但它们都包括关键字、标识符、运算符、控制结构等基本元素。在编程中,我们需要遵循语法规则编写正确的代码,否则程序将无法正确执行。四、逻辑
逻辑是程序的控制流程和决策的关键。它决定了程序在不同条件下的执行路径和结果。逻辑包括条件判断、循环和分支等结构,用于控制程序的执行流程。在编程中,我们需要合理运用逻辑结构,使程序能够正确、高效地执行。综上所述,编程的核心要素包括数据、算法、语法和逻辑。它们相互依赖,共同构成了一个完整的程序。掌握这些核心要素,对于理解和编写程序是至关重要的。
1年前